Eugenie Sin Sing Tan is a scholar working on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, Dermatology and Pollution. According to data from OpenAlex, Eugenie Sin Sing Tan has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 259 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, 5 papers in Dermatology and 3 papers in Pollution. Recurrent topics in Eugenie Sin Sing Tan’s work include Skin Protection and Aging (4 papers), Air Quality and Health Impacts (3 papers) and Regulation and Function of Hair Follicle Stem Cells (2 papers). Eugenie Sin Sing Tan is often cited by papers focused on Skin Protection and Aging (4 papers), Air Quality and Health Impacts (3 papers) and Regulation and Function of Hair Follicle Stem Cells (2 papers). Eugenie Sin Sing Tan collaborates with scholars based in Malaysia, United Kingdom and Canada. Eugenie Sin Sing Tan's co-authors include Yu Bin Ho, Farahnaz Amini, H. S. Lim, Hafizan Juahir and Mohamad Pauzi Zakaria and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Scientific Reports and Nutrients.
